Re: 40 Ford Shock Rebuilders
Seems that there are so many correct '40 shocks out there on the swap meet market that shocks that seem sound should be tested in service. In recent months I have stacked up candidate shocks, perhaps to an excess. They could be a good bet for someone trying to save serious money on a '40 project. The trick is to move the shock through a full range of motion by hand while looking for worn shafts. Seldom pay over $20. Could also be that so many '40 parts in SoCal that it doesn't apply to many other areas. One of very few advantages living out here. Still need to mention it. Good Luck: Fred A
